A Case of Ganglioglioma ; Radiologically Malignant but Histologically Benign Tumor

Abstract
Gangliogliomas are rare tumors of the central nervous system, composed of neoplastic ganglion cells and neoplastic glial cells. They are characterized by slow growing, low incidence of malignancy, surgically curable, and usually occurred in children and young adults. We report a case of ganglioglioma occurred in 21 year-old male which radiological findings were compatible with the malignancy but histologically diagnosed as benign, with review of literatures.
